연구실 소개

조원광 교수의 연구실은 디지털 데이터 기반의 공공보건 및 사회심리적 영향을 분석하는 데 초점을 맞추고 있습니다. 특히 온라인 커뮤니티, 미디어 보도, 공적 보건 데이터를 활용해 전염병 확산 과정에서의 정보 유통, 공중의 정서와 인식 변화, 메시지 프레임이 정책 수용에 미치는 영향을 탐구합니다. 연구는 자연어 처리와 네트워크 분석 기법을 기반으로 하며, 실질적 보건 정책 수립에 기여할 수 있는 실증적 근거를 제공합니다.

Characteristics of South Korea"s early response to the public health crisis and their implications: Topic modeling of early media coverage of MERS and COVID-19
Wonkwang Jo
FWCI 5.6Information Society & Media

이 연구는 메르스와 코로나19 초기 한국 주요 미디어의 보도를 분석함으로써, 한국사회의 감염병 위기 대응에서 나타난 특징과 함의를 탐구한다. 이 연구는 한국에서 메르스 환자 발생 초기와 (2015년 5월 20일 – 6월 23일) 코로나19 환자 발생 초기의 미디어 보도를 (2020년 1월 20일 – 2월 23일) 수집하여 Structural Topic Model 등의 방법을 적용하여 분석하였다. 주요 결과는 다음과 같다. 1) 정치적 입장이 감염병 위기에 대응하는 태도와 관점에 영향을 미치는 것으로 추정된다. 주요 신문들의 감염병 보도량과 주제의 구성이, 해당 매체와 당시 정부의 정치적 성향이 유사한지 아니면 차이나는지에 따라 달라지는 것으로 나타났다. 2) 코로나19에서는 감염병을 최초 발견 지역과 연계하여 설명하는 서사가 메르스에 비해 더 많이 관찰되었다. 한국 사회가 현재, 그리고 향후 감염병 대응에서 부작용을 최소화하며 지혜롭게 대응하기 위해서는, 이런 특징을 참조할 필요가
